Early intervention

When a child shows signs of a developmental delay, early intervention can make a life-changing difference. Services such as comprehensive programs including case management and IFSPs help guide families through this important process.

Recognizing developmental delay early gives families the chance to take action with appropriate services. It’s essential to start early services and work with an early interventionist to address concerns.

For families in South Carolina, Babynet is the first step in the early intervention journey. Through Babynet, children are evaluated for developmental delays and connected with appropriate resources and professionals.

Families and professionals collaborate on an IFSP to create a roadmap for support and progress. This document includes a personalized approach that guides early intervention efforts over time. The IFSP is reviewed regularly and updated as the child grows and changes.

With strong case management, early intervention becomes a structured and efficient process for the family. A case manager monitors implementation of services, connects families to community resources, and supports consistent care.

The early interventionist is a trained professional who works directly with families and children to address delays and promote development. These specialists offer support in areas such as communication, gross and fine motor skills, social-emotional development, and problem-solving.

With early intervention, parents are equipped with tools and strategies to support their child at home. This approach creates a team environment between parents and professionals.

Research shows that children who receive early services often require fewer supports later in school. From the initial Babynet screening to ongoing IFSP reviews, families are guided through a personalized, caring process.

In summary, programs like Babynet, IFSPs, and case management offer lifelines for families facing uncertainty and concern about their child’s development.
